What are Bifold Door Seals?

Bifold door seals are the rubber or vinyl strips connected to the edges of bifold doors, developed to create a tight seal in between the door panels and the frame. These seals serve a number of functions:

Types of Replacement Bifold Door Seals

There are several types of replacement bifold door seals readily available, each created for specific door types and applications:
Foam tape seals: These are the most common kind of seal, made from foam tape connected to the door edges.Vinyl bulb seals: These seals include a vinyl bulb that compresses to create a tight seal.Magnetic seals: These seals use a magnetic strip to attach to the door frame, developing a strong seal.Adhesive-backed seals: These seals have a self-adhesive support, making them easy to install.
When to Replace Bifold Door Seals?

Bifold door seals can last for several years, but they might need to be replaced if:
You discover air leaks: If you feel drafts or notice air leakages around the door, it's likely that the seal is compromised.Water enters the space: If water gets in the room during heavy rain or flooding, the seal might be damaged or used out.The door becomes tough to run: If the door ends up being stiff or difficult to open and close, it may be due to a worn-out seal.You see indications of wear and tear: If the seal is broken, torn, or breakable, it's time to replace it.
How to Install Replacement Bifold Door Seals

Installing replacement bifold door seals is a relatively simple procedure:
Clean the door edges: Remove any dirt, gunk, or old adhesive from the door edges.Procedure the door: Measure the door to determine the proper seal size.Cut the seal: Cut the seal to the required length using an energy knife or scissors.Use the seal: Apply the seal to the door edges, making sure a tight fit.

Regularly Asked Questions

Q: Can I use any type of seal for my bifold door?A: No, it's necessary to choose a seal particularly created for your door type and application.

Q: How often should I replace bifold door seals?A: Seals can last for several years, but it's suggested to inspect them frequently and replace them every 5-10 years or as needed.

Q: Can I install replacement seals myself?A: Yes, setting up replacement seals is a relatively simple process, but if you're not comfortable with DIY jobs, it's advised to hire a professional.

Q: Are replacement bifold door seals expensive?A: Replacement seals can differ in cost, depending upon the type and quality, however they are usually a budget friendly service compared to replacing the whole door.
